Partager via


X509Credentials2 Classe

public class X509Credentials2 extends SecurityCredentials

Spécifie les informations d’identification de sécurité basées sur les certificats X.509 spécifiés à l’aide du chemin du certificat.

Récapitulatif du constructeur

Constructeur Description
X509Credentials2(String certificatePath)

Crée une instance de la classe system.fabric.X509Credentials2.

Résumé de la méthode

Modificateur et type Méthode et description
String getCertificateLoadPath()

Indique l’emplacement du fichier/dossier du certificat

ProtectionLevel getProtectionLevel()

Obtient la façon dont la communication est protégée, la valeur par défaut est ENCRYPTANDSIGN.

List<String> getRemoteCertThumbprints()

Obtient la liste des empreintes de certificat distant utilisées pour valider les données X509Credentials distantes

List<X509Name> getRemoteX509Names()

Obtient la liste de X509Name pour valider les X509Credentials distants

void setProtectionLevel(ProtectionLevel protectionLevel)

Définit la façon dont la communication est protégée, la valeur par défaut est ENCRYPTANDSIGN.

Membres hérités

Détails du constructeur

X509Credentials2

public X509Credentials2(String certificatePath)

Crée une instance de la classe system.fabric.X509Credentials2.

Paramètres:

certificatePath - Emplacement du certificat X509

Détails de la méthode

getCertificateLoadPath

public String getCertificateLoadPath()

Indique l’emplacement du fichier/dossier du certificat

Retours:

Emplacement du certificat de nom.

getProtectionLevel

public ProtectionLevel getProtectionLevel()

Obtient la façon dont la communication est protégée, la valeur par défaut est ENCRYPTANDSIGN.

Retours:

Niveau de protection des informations d’identification.

getRemoteCertThumbprints

public List getRemoteCertThumbprints()

Obtient la liste des empreintes de certificat distant utilisées pour valider les données X509Credentials distantes

Retours:

Liste des empreintes de certificat distant, utilisées pour valider les données X509Credentials distantes

getRemoteX509Names

public List getRemoteX509Names()

Obtient la liste de X509Name pour valider les X509Credentials distants

Retours:

liste de X509Name pour valider les X509Credentials distants

setProtectionLevel

public void setProtectionLevel(ProtectionLevel protectionLevel)

Définit la façon dont la communication est protégée, la valeur par défaut est ENCRYPTANDSIGN.

Paramètres:

protectionLevel - Niveau de protection des informations d’identification.

S’applique à